    An Intimate Lunch, Styled in Blue

    Month-to-month, we very carefully curate an unique consuming experience for our individuals, and July was no exception. This month’s style– “Tones of Blue” — looked like throughout the tablescape, with blue blossom configurations , split table battery chargers , and soft-hued accents that brought a feeling of tranquil sophistication to our summer season lunch.

    These thoughtful, themed info most likely to the heart of EWE Dinner Club Our team believe in raised enjoyable , where additionally the tiniest touch contributes to the total experience. Whether it’s the color plan, the area, or the food selection, every information is curated with intent.
